B cells and autoantibodies in the pathogenesis of hypertension [ 2018 - 2021 ]

Researchers: Prof Grant Drummond (Principal investigator) ,  Dr Antony Vinh Prof Christopher Sobey

Brief description This project aims to gain a better understanding of the causes of hypertension. Specifically, we will test the idea that activation of the immune system and the production of antibodies is a major cause of the blood vessel and kidney damage that leads to high blood pressure. Such findings could pave the way for new treatment approaches where drugs currently reserved for patients with autoimmune diseases (e.g. rheumatoid arthritis, gout) are re-purposed for the treatment of hypertension.

Funding Amount $AUD 865,286.76
